数据库的散热量如何计算

数据库的散热量如何计算

数据库的散热量如何计算这个问题可以通过几个关键因素来回答:设备功耗、环境温度、散热方式。其中,设备功耗是最重要的,因为它直接决定了散热量的大小。为了详细描述,我们可以深入探讨设备功耗的计算方法及其在数据库散热量计算中的应用。

一、设备功耗

1、了解设备功耗

设备功耗是指数据库服务器及其相关设备在运行过程中消耗的电能。通常,服务器的功耗可以通过以下几种方式获取:

  • 制造商提供的规格书:大多数服务器制造商会在设备规格书中提供详细的功耗信息。
  • 实际测量:使用功耗测量设备,如功率计,直接测量服务器在不同负载下的功耗。
  • 估算方法:根据服务器的配置及其组件的功耗,进行估算。例如,CPU、内存、硬盘等各自的功耗总和。

2、功耗转化为散热量

根据物理学定律,电能消耗的同时会产生等量的热能。因此,数据库设备的功耗直接转化为散热量。具体计算公式如下:

[ Q = P times t ]

其中,Q表示散热量(单位:焦耳),P表示功耗(单位:瓦特),t表示时间(单位:秒)。

举例说明:假设一台服务器的功耗为500瓦,那么在1小时(3600秒)内,其散热量为:

[ Q = 500 times 3600 = 1,800,000 text{ 焦耳} ]

二、环境温度

1、环境温度对散热量的影响

环境温度是指数据库服务器所在机房的温度。环境温度越高,服务器散热的难度越大。因此,在设计数据中心的散热方案时,必须考虑环境温度的影响。通常,数据中心会通过空调系统控制环境温度,以保持在一个合理的范围内。

2、温度差对散热效率的影响

散热效率与服务器内部温度和环境温度的差值密切相关。温度差越大,散热效率越高。因此,在高温环境中,需要更强的散热系统来维持设备的正常运行。

三、散热方式

1、主动散热和被动散热

  • 主动散热:通过风扇、空调等设备主动降低服务器内部温度。这种方式的散热效率较高,但同时也会增加能耗。
  • 被动散热:通过自然对流、散热片等方式被动散热。这种方式能耗较低,但散热效率相对较低。

2、液冷与风冷

  • 液冷:通过液体(如冷却水)带走服务器产生的热量。这种方式散热效率极高,适用于高密度数据中心。
  • 风冷:通过空气流动带走热量。这种方式应用广泛,但在高密度环境中散热效果有限。

3、散热设备和布局

在设计数据中心时,散热设备和布局同样重要。合理的布局可以最大化散热效率,如热通道和冷通道的设计。

四、计算实例

1、案例分析

假设一个数据中心有100台服务器,每台服务器的功耗为500瓦,环境温度为25摄氏度,通过风冷方式散热。我们需要计算整个数据中心的散热量。

2、步骤

  1. 计算单台服务器的散热量

    [ Q_{单台} = 500 times 3600 = 1,800,000 text{ 焦耳/小时} ]

  2. 计算总散热量

    [ Q_{总} = Q_{单台} times 100 = 1,800,000 times 100 = 180,000,000 text{ 焦耳/小时} ]

  3. 考虑环境温度:环境温度为25摄氏度,通过风冷方式散热。

3、结果和分析

最终,整个数据中心每小时需要散热180,000,000焦耳的热量。为了保证数据中心的正常运行,需要配置足够的散热设备,并合理布局以提高散热效率。

五、优化散热方案

1、提高设备效率

使用高效能的服务器设备,可以在同样的计算能力下减少功耗,从而降低散热量。

2、改进散热技术

采用液冷技术或其他高效散热技术,可以显著提高散热效率,适应高密度数据中心的需求。

3、环境控制

通过先进的空调系统和环境监控系统,保持数据中心环境温度在一个合理的范围内,减少散热压力。

4、使用先进的管理系统

使用研发项目管理系统PingCode和通用项目协作软件Worktile,可以优化数据中心的管理,提高整体效率,从而间接减少散热需求。

总结来说,数据库的散热量计算主要依赖于设备功耗、环境温度、散热方式三个关键因素。通过合理的设计和优化,可以有效控制和管理数据中心的散热问题,确保设备的稳定运行。

相关问答FAQs:

1. 数据库散热量计算有哪些方法?

  • 传统的方法是根据数据库服务器的功耗和散热系数来计算散热量。通过测量服务器的功耗,然后根据服务器的散热系数来计算散热量。
  • 另一种方法是使用热模型来计算散热量。热模型是通过测量数据库服务器的温度分布和散热器的性能来建立的数学模型,可以准确计算散热量。

2. 数据库散热量计算与服务器配置有关吗?
是的,数据库散热量的计算与服务器的配置密切相关。服务器的配置包括处理器的类型和数量、内存容量、硬盘容量等因素,这些因素会影响服务器的功耗和散热量。

3. 如何降低数据库的散热量?

  • 使用高效的散热器和风扇可以提高散热效率,降低数据库的散热量。
  • 合理规划数据库服务器的布局,确保服务器之间有足够的空间,避免热量积聚。
  • 定期清理服务器内部的灰尘和杂物,保持散热器和风扇的畅通。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2049412

(0)
Edit1Edit1
上一篇 2天前
下一篇 2天前
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部